A fiery and intensely flavorful Rajasthani mutton curry, Laal Maas is renowned for its vibrant red hue and rich, spicy taste. Traditionally made with tender lamb or goat meat slow-cooked in a gravy infused with dried Mathania red chilies, garlic, ginger, and yogurt, this dish offers a complex balance of heat and aromatic spices. It's a culinary emblem of Rajasthan, often associated with royal feasts and warrior traditions.
Poulet Bicyclette is a flavorful chicken dish originating from West Africa, popular in Gabon. It involves boiling chicken in a spiced broth, then marinating and grilling it to perfection. The name is thought to relate to the simplicity of its preparation, akin to riding a bicycle.

Kelewele is a popular Ghanaian street food made from ripe plantains, cut into cubes, seasoned with spices like ginger, cayenne pepper, and nutmeg, then deep-fried until golden brown and slightly crispy. It's often enjoyed as a snack or a side dish.

Ga Kenkey is a popular Ghanaian dish made from fermented corn dough, steamed in corn husks until firm. It has a distinct tangy flavor and a dense texture, often served as a side to various stews and sauces. This recipe pairs it with Shito, a spicy Ghanaian black pepper sauce, and crispy fried fish, creating a classic and satisfying meal.
